Boston Dynamics' robots spark a mix of fascination and concern, leading to speculation about their intended uses, from weapons to household helpers. Founded in 1992 as a spin-off from MIT and Carnegie Mellon by Mark Raibert, the company initially received significant funding from the US Military and DARPA, which has fueled public skepticism about their motives. With each viral video showcasing their advanced robots, questions arise regarding whether these machines are designed for combat or assistance. To address these concerns, Raibert has downplayed fears about the robots being used as weapons, comparing them to cars and computers in terms of potential applications.
